Braves Franchise History 2005 – Albert Pujols wins the MVP Award in the National League beating out Braves outfielder Andruw Jones. Pujols hit .330 with 41 home runs and 117 RBI and received 18 of 31 first-place votes. Jones hit .263 with a league best 51 home runs and 128 RBI. He also won his […]
